Luffy, is in search of the island Raftel (The home of the famous treasure One Piece) at the end of the Grand Line, a strip of unique islands.&amp;nbsp; Luffy&apos;s group has brought quite a bit of attention to themselves, and even though they haven&apos;t really done anything particularly criminal or evil (Quite the opposite, actually), the government is constantly after them for the simple reason that they&apos;re pirates.&amp;nbsp; Rival pirates, and there are a lot of them, also frequently serve as obstacles to the crew.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Objects To Know&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;There are a few odd/unique names that may in one way or another get a name drop.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Tom&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;A jolly Fish-man who taught Iceberg basically all he knows about carpentry: His role model.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Galley-La Company&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/b&gt;Company run by Iceberg that builds high-quality ships using super special awesome techniques.&amp;nbsp; Their logo appears to be a curly silhouette of a ship:&amp;nbsp; Iceberg has a red pattern of similar shapes tattooed on his upper arms and shoulders.&amp;nbsp; Galley-La is the combined effort of seven companies that were united under Iceberg.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Water 7&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/b&gt;A huge island/city in the Grand Line vaguely resembling Venice: Iceberg is its beloved Mayor.&amp;nbsp; There are waterways leading to almost every part of the city, and it is topped by a huge fountain.&amp;nbsp; The name Water 7 comes from the fact that there used to be seven shipbuilding companies, but they were eventually merged by Iceberg.&amp;nbsp; There are still numbered docks, Number One being the largest and most prestigious.&amp;nbsp;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The city has an extremely diverse and ever-changing population.&amp;nbsp; It is a popular destination for all sorts of travelers due to the reputation of its shipwrights.&amp;nbsp; &quot;Travelers&quot; also includes pirates, who sometimes cause an uproar.&amp;nbsp; They are swiftly brought down by the Galley-La shipwrights, who seem to be the equivalent of a police force.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Despite the control and benevolence of the Galley-La company shipwrights, there was an underground syndicate in existence:&amp;nbsp; The Franky Family.&amp;nbsp; Run by Iceberg&apos;s childhood friend/rival, this group destroyed ships and robbed travelers.&amp;nbsp; Most of Water 7 fears this group, especially their leader.&amp;nbsp; Recently, the Franky Family&apos;s leader left Water 7, and they were all offered jobs from the Galley-La company.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Puffing Tom/Sea Train&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/b&gt;A train that runs on a track over the sea.&amp;nbsp; This was Tom&apos;s last major building project, and it remains an incredible piece of machinery to this day.&amp;nbsp; It is run by Kokoro, a mermaid and a personal friend of Iceberg.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Log Pose&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Mentioned (and frequently explained) in my first post, a Log Pose is a hollow glass sphere with a needle suspended in it.&amp;nbsp; Like a compass, it always points to the island that it is configured to point at.&amp;nbsp; There are two main kinds - &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;&lt;i&gt;Normal Log Poses&lt;/i&gt;&lt;/b&gt;, which are usually un-labeled: These Poses will point to a certain island after a certain period of time in that location. Every island has a different amount of time that it takes to register its location.&amp;nbsp; These are usually favored by pirates.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;i&gt;&lt;b&gt;Eternal Poses&lt;/b&gt;,&lt;/i&gt; which always, ALWAYS point to a certain island.&amp;nbsp; They often come in a wooden frame with a name plate indicating the name of the island that it points to.&amp;nbsp; They are most often used by Marines or by people with a home or affinity on a specific island.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Den Den Mushi&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;This is One Piece&apos;s telephone.&amp;nbsp; It&apos;s a snail, and you talk into it, and another snail sends your voice and copies your expression to the person you&apos;re talking to.&amp;nbsp; They usually greatly resemble their owners, and seem to come in two sizes: a relatively large phone, or a compact mobile version that is often worn on the wrist.&amp;nbsp; There are a few specialized versions (such as one specifically meant for wiretapping), but these are pretty uncommon.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Berī&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The currency of One Piece.&amp;nbsp; Berī is paper money used in the One Piece world.&amp;nbsp; Its spelling is often disputed, so I&apos;ll stick to the best phonetic spelling I can figure out.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Devil Fruit&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Devil Fruits are weird-ass fruits that give the person who eats them a special ability - in exchange for their ability to swim.&amp;nbsp; It is said that a Devil Fruit contains a devil (hence the name), and that once a devil enters a person, the sea hates them for it.&amp;nbsp; A Devil Fruit can give someone the ability to alter their body (stretching, splitting into pieces, growing extra limbs, etc.), turn into an animal (either partially or fully), or turn themselves into something usually classified as something natural such as sand, ice, or fire.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Geography&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The regions of the One Piece world consist mostly of the &quot;Blues,&quot; which are just big ol&apos; seas with lots of islands.&amp;nbsp; There&apos;s the North, South, East, and West Blues - their names are based on their locations in comparison with the two &quot;Lines&quot; - the Red Line a continent that circles the world in the North and South, and the Grand Line, an island chain that circles the world in the East and West.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;A few character details&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/b&gt;I&apos;m sticking a few details in here that may pop up in-character that are buried in my application post somewhere for easy accessibility.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Tyrannosaurus&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Tyrannosaurus is a white mouse that follows Iceberg everywhere.&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; He can often be found climbing around on Iceberg&apos;s shoulder, in his shirt pocket, or just generally climbing around on him.&amp;nbsp; Iceberg is extremely protective of him.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Nmaa&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Iceberg frequently says &quot;Nma&quot; before saying anything else. Sometimes it is translated as “Well” but I prefer to leave it as something more of a noise than a word.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;strike&gt;&lt;b&gt;The Bandages&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Iceberg was pretty recently shot six times.&amp;nbsp; Even if/when he&apos;s totally recovered, chances are he probably wouldn&apos;t know when to take the bandages off anyway.&lt;/strike&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Gunshots&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;If you would like me to show you where exactly Iceberg was shot for any reason, please let me know!&amp;nbsp; I can pinpoint basically all of the shots except two.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Violence&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Iceberg does NOT like violence and &lt;i&gt;rarely&lt;/i&gt; condones it.&amp;nbsp; There are occasions where he feels that it can be justified, but they are few and far between.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Secrecy&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Iceberg is an excellent liar, especially when it comes to making huge understatements or covering things up.&amp;nbsp; A true politician.&amp;nbsp; o/&apos;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Blood tells the truth&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Lie detector tests work like a charm.&amp;nbsp; When lying about certain things, Iceberg&apos;s pulse skyrockets.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Living Conditions&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Iceberg is used to living in a mansion in a huge city where everyone loves him and would do just about anything for him.&amp;nbsp; Needless to say, this island is going to be hard to get used to.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Young!Iceberg!&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/b&gt;Young!Iceberg is much different than his older self.&amp;nbsp; Essentially, he&apos;s about a million times more serious&amp;nbsp; and condescending as a kid.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/b&gt;&lt;a name=&quot;cutid1&quot;&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;div class=&quot;ljcut&quot; text=&quot;Profile&quot;&gt;&lt;b&gt;Your character&apos;s name:&lt;/b&gt; Iceberg (No other name given)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Series your character&apos;s from&lt;/b&gt;: One Piece&lt;br /&gt;&lt;b&gt;Background:&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Serving as the Mayor of the island Water 7 and President/Manager of the Galley-La shipbuilding company, his skill and loyalty earned him the love and respect of his fellow citizens and shipwrights – to the point that many of them risk their lives for his honor and safety. His skill is often overshadowed by his immaturity - in one famous example, when Iceberg&apos;s secretary gave him a list of tasks to be done, he responded by shouting, &quot;I don&apos;t wanna!&quot; In other cases, he is known for tearing up his mail if he dislikes it, pretending he isn&apos;t home if someone he dislikes wants to speak with him, and for taking care of a random animal that he finds. In reality, his immaturity and ignorance are an act – he is well regarded by his peers as the most skilled carpenter in the world. Why does Iceberg play stupid? To conceal potentially deadly information from the government, of course!&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Iceberg spent his childhood and early adulthood with the young Cutty Flam (&quot;Franky&quot;) as the apprentices of the exceedingly jolly and world-famous shipwright Tom. While Franky spent most of his time building miniature battleships, Iceberg spent his learning from Tom and scolding Franky for his stupidity. The (relative) peace of things was suddenly disrupted when Tom was arrested - the World Government put him on trial for the construction of &lt;i&gt;Oro Jackson,&lt;/i&gt; a famous pirate ship. Tom brought forth a proposal - he would build a revolutionary new system of transportation if the government let him free. Within the time spent building this system, strange men from a secret police force known as CP5 frequently visited Tom and always left in a rage. These men desired a valuable and dangerous blueprint possessed by Tom - the instructions to build an ancient battleship, Pluton.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The building of the new transportation system, a train that runs over the sea called &quot;Puffing Tom,&quot; was a success and resurrected Water 7&apos;s dying economy. As the government&apos;s Judiciary ship was making its way to Water 7 to place its final judgment on Tom, something strange happened - Men hired by CP5 hijacked a group of &quot;Battle Franky&quot; ships and attacked the city, injuring both Iceberg and Tom in the process. Iceberg placed the blame firmly on Franky, claiming that he would never offer forgiveness for hurting Tom.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;From that point, things got even worse. Government officials arrested Tom, Franky, and Iceberg. The Judge presented Tom with a choice: He could be pardoned for the crime of building the &lt;i&gt;Oro Jackson,&lt;/i&gt; or his apprentices could be pardoned for attacking Water 7. The verdict was announced - Tom was to be taken to the prison Impel Down and executed and his apprentices set free. Due to Franky&apos;s feeling of responsibility for Tom&apos;s arrest, he worked to prevent it as much as possible, supposedly dying in the process.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Before Tom&apos;s departure, Iceberg was entrusted with the blueprints to the legendary ship that the government sought after. Knowing the dangers of owning such blueprints, he concealed the fact that he owned them from even his closest associates. Four years after Tom&apos;s death, though, something strange happened - Cutty Flam requested to see Iceberg. Meeting in secret, Iceberg handed off the plans for the weapon to his childhood rival, reminding Franky that he will never be forgiven for building the ships that resulted in Tom&apos;s conviction, but tearfully announcing his happiness upon discovering that he was alive.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The government continued to harass Iceberg about the blueprints, to which he responded by feigning ignorance, claiming to be away from home, or simply refusing to comment.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The arrival of the &quot;Straw-hat&quot; pirate crew triggered the most dramatic and violent portion of the government&apos;s plan to retrieve the blueprints. Iceberg was found on the floor of the Galley-La main office (his home) one morning with five bullet wounds (Two in the front, three in the back.). This assassination attempt from Nico Robin and overseen by a masked man put Water 7 in a state of panic, and forced Iceberg to reveal his seriousness and intelligence.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The assassins reappeared, and almost immediately upon their entry another of their&apos; bullets pierced Iceberg&apos;s left shoulder. His main guardians were distracted by strange costumed figures (or in some cases, *being* those costumed figures). The man accompanying Robin exited, claiming that he had other business to deal with, leaving Iceberg and Robin alone. The two quickly drew pistols at each other, Iceberg explaining that through Robin’s knowledge and his skill, the government would undoubtedly rebuild the Pluton ship which would inevitably result in a massive power struggle and unfathomable destruction. To avoid such a devastating event, he claimed, he would have to kill Robin, the only living person who could read the language written on the blueprints. She quickly disarmed him and once again held him at gunpoint, asking if he had anything else to say. To this he simply responded that she had been deceived. Robin quickly summoned her associates to meet in the bedroom to discuss this problem.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;When the group assembled, they each unmasked themselves - most of them had been employed at the Galley-La Company for a period of about five years. These individuals, after finding fake blueprints for the ship, performed a makeshift lie detector test using Iceberg&apos;s pulse and a series of questions to find the true location of the blueprints. Unable to hide his agitation, his pulse skyrocketed, indicating his lies. Suddenly, the remaining Straw-hat pirates, along with Paulie, burst into the room and had a brief conflict with the CP9 members that ultimately resulted in Iceberg and Paulie being tied together in a flaming building and rescued by the Strawhats&apos; reindeer. Yeah.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;To make the incident even more of a pain in the ass, the annual &quot;Aqua Laguna,&quot; essentially a ginormous storm that usually destroys or damages the entire city, was worse than ever this year. CP9 detained Franky, and the Straw-Hats, teaming up with the Franky Family, set out to rescue their friends.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;When the Straw-hat Pirates returned, Iceberg met with Franky and described a massive building project that he wanted to accomplish - to take after their collective hero Tom and build something innovative to improve the lives of the people living in Water 7. He revealed his plan to, essentially, make Water 7 into a giant ship so that it would never flood or sink again. In addition to this, he also indicated that he finally forgave Franky for giving the government a scapegoat to take Tom away.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Overall, Iceberg is (supposedly) exceedingly easy to deal with if he likes or is neutral with someone, and next to impossible to deal with if he dislikes them.
